Output 8043d3dd00588862099ffe9b3904cfeab1dca83ed32c23abcdf095711994cc2f:0

value
126043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c79226b407a380d287c926621e6a98516c73065 OP_EQUAL
address
32py9R1cBDRiagJn17V4prkHoFiSqNS2zq
transaction
8043d3dd00588862099ffe9b3904cfeab1dca83ed32c23abcdf095711994cc2f
spent
true